About Timothy
Timothy J. Harrington earned his undergraduate degree in 1984 from Wayne State University and his law degree from the University of Detroit Law School in 1990, where he served as an associate editor of the University of Detroit Law Review and a member of the editorial board of the Michigan Business Law Journal.
Mr. Harrington's areas of practice are: 1) Commercial transactions including all manner of purchase and sale agreements, commercial lending transactions and other secured transactions; 2) Commercial litigation including all manner of contract disputes and business torts; 3) Commercial loan documentation; 4) Personal injury matters, including auto negligence, premises liability, construction site/contractor liability, product liability, and medical and other professional malpractice; 5) Property damage claims; 6) Subrogation and indemnity claims; and 7) Insurance disputes.
Mr. Harrington is admitted to practice in Michigan and Texas, and in all federal courts in those jurisdictions.
